Eid al-Adha, the second of two great festivals in Islam, the other being Eid al-Fitr. Eid al-Adha marks the culmination of the hajj (pilgrimage) rites at Minā, Saudi Arabia, near Mecca, but is celebrated by Muslims throughout the world. Eid al-Adha, also known as the “Festival of Sacrifice,” commemorates the profound act of faith shown by Prophet Ibrahim, who was willing to sacrifice his son in obedience to God’s command. Eid al-Adha falls on the 10th of Dhu al-Hijjah, right after the Day of Arafah when pilgrims stand in prayer on the plain of Arafat. In this context, on Eid day, pilgrims complete key Hajj rites, including the symbolic Stoning of the Devil and their animal sacrifice. Eid al-Fitr (Arabic: عُيْدُ الفِطْر) – Occurring on the 1st day of the Islamic month of Shawwal, Eid al-Fitr marks the end of a month’s worth of fasting and devotion during the holy month of Ramadan.
